Is Legnano Sauce Pesto Genovese Vggf - 6.5 Oz Dairy Free?


Ingredients
basil, sunflower oil, cashews, potato flakes (potatoes, spices, sulphites), tofu (yellow soybeans, water, nigari sea salt), extra-virgin olive oil, pine nuts, salt, sugar, garlic, glucono-delta lactone (to regulate acidity)
What is a Dairy Free diet?
A dairy-free diet eliminates all foods made from or containing milk and milk-derived ingredients, such as butter, cheese, yogurt, and cream. It's essential for people with lactose intolerance, milk allergies, or those who prefer plant-based alternatives. Common dairy substitutes include almond, soy, oat, and coconut-based milks and cheeses. While dairy is a major source of calcium and vitamin D, these nutrients can be replaced through fortified foods or supplements. Many people find going dairy-free helps reduce digestive issues, acne, or inflammation, but balance and proper nutrient intake remain key for long-term health.
